Chinese Zodiac Elements Calculator Formula and Mathematical Explanation
The calculation for the Chinese Zodiac Animal, Element, and Yin/Yang polarity is based on simple mathematical operations applied to your birth year. The Chinese Zodiac Elements Calculator uses these formulas to derive your unique profile.
Step-by-step Derivation:
- Determine the Zodiac Animal: The 12 Chinese zodiac animals follow a fixed cycle. To find your animal, a common method is to use the formula
(Birth Year - 1900) % 12. The result corresponds to an index in the animal sequence (Rat, Ox, Tiger, Rabbit, Dragon, Snake, Horse, Goat, Monkey, Rooster, Dog, Pig). For example, if the result is 0, it’s a Rat year; if 1, it’s an Ox year, and so on. - Determine the Zodiac Element: The five elements (Wood, Fire, Earth, Metal, Water) cycle over 10 years, with each element ruling for two consecutive years. The element is determined by the last digit of your birth year.
- Years ending in 0 or 1: Metal
- Years ending in 2 or 3: Water
- Years ending in 4 or 5: Wood
- Years ending in 6 or 7: Fire
- Years ending in 8 or 9: Earth
This can be calculated by taking
Birth Year % 10and mapping the result. - Determine Yin/Yang Polarity: Polarity is simpler. Even-numbered years are associated with Yang, representing active, masculine energy. Odd-numbered years are associated with Yin, representing passive, feminine energy. This is found by checking if
Birth Year % 2 == 0(Yang) orBirth Year % 2 != 0(Yin).

Practical Examples (Real-World Use Cases)
Understanding your Chinese zodiac animal and element can offer fascinating insights into your personality and potential interactions with others. Here are a couple of examples using our Chinese Zodiac Elements Calculator:
Example 1: Born in 1984
- Input: Birth Year = 1984
- Calculation:
- Animal: (1984 – 1900) % 12 = 84 % 12 = 0. This corresponds to the Rat.
- Element: Last digit is 4. Years ending in 4 or 5 are Wood.
- Polarity: 1984 is an even year, so it’s Yang.
- Output: Wood Rat (Yang)
- Interpretation: A Wood Rat is often seen as intelligent, adaptable, and resourceful (Rat traits), with the added qualities of growth, creativity, and generosity from the Wood element. The Yang polarity suggests an outgoing and active nature.
Example 2: Born in 1991
- Input: Birth Year = 1991
- Calculation:
- Animal: (1991 – 1900) % 12 = 91 % 12 = 7. This corresponds to the Goat.
- Element: Last digit is 1. Years ending in 0 or 1 are Metal.
- Polarity: 1991 is an odd year, so it’s Yin.
- Output: Metal Goat (Yin)
- Interpretation: A Metal Goat (or Sheep) is typically gentle, artistic, and compassionate (Goat traits), combined with the strength, resilience, and determination of the Metal element. The Yin polarity suggests a more introspective and nurturing disposition.

Key Factors That Affect Chinese Zodiac Elements Calculator Results
The results from a Chinese Zodiac Elements Calculator are primarily determined by a single, crucial factor: your birth year. However, understanding the nuances of how this year is interpreted within Chinese astrology reveals several underlying “factors” that shape the outcome:
- The 12-Year Animal Cycle: This is the most fundamental factor. Each of the 12 animals (Rat, Ox, Tiger, Rabbit, Dragon, Snake, Horse, Goat, Monkey, Rooster, Dog, Pig) governs a specific year in a repeating cycle. Your birth year directly maps to one of these animals. This cycle dictates your primary zodiac identity.
- The 5-Element Cycle (10-Year Cycle): Beyond the animal, each year is also associated with one of the five elements: Wood, Fire, Earth, Metal, and Water. This element is determined by the last digit of your birth year and cycles every 10 years (each element appearing for two consecutive years). The element adds a layer of depth to your animal’s characteristics, influencing personality traits and tendencies.
- Yin and Yang Polarity: Every year, and thus every animal-element combination, carries either a Yin (feminine, passive, receptive) or Yang (masculine, active, assertive) polarity. This is determined by whether the birth year is odd (Yin) or even (Yang). The polarity further refines the expression of your animal and element traits.
- Lunar New Year vs. Gregorian Calendar: While most simple Chinese Zodiac Elements Calculator tools use the Gregorian calendar year for convenience, traditional Chinese astrology begins its new year on the Lunar New Year (which falls between late January and mid-February). If your birthday is in January or early February, your actual Chinese zodiac animal and element might be from the *previous* Gregorian year. This is a critical factor for precise readings.
- The 60-Year Cycle (Jiazi): The combination of the 12 animals and 5 elements creates a larger 60-year cycle, known as the “Jiazi” cycle. Each year within this cycle has a unique animal-element pairing (e.g., Wood Dragon, Fire Snake). This complete cycle ensures that each specific animal-element combination only repeats every 60 years, making each birth year truly unique within this grand cycle.
- The Five Elements Theory: The philosophical underpinnings of the five elements (Wood, Fire, Earth, Metal, Water) are crucial. Each element is associated with specific qualities, directions, seasons, colors, and even organs. Understanding these broader associations enriches the interpretation of your elemental sign, providing context for your personality and potential interactions with the world.
